Iit bombay cs 348 12 some smtp commands helo identifies the client to the server, fully qualified domain name, only sent once per session mail initiate a message transfer, fully qualified domain of originator rcpt follows mail, identifies an addressee, typically the fully qualified name of the addressee for multiple addressees use one rcpt for each addressee.
